Side affects of Accutane

Dear Ask The Doctor: Hi doc, I'm a healthy 19 year old male, I've been taking accutane for the past 2 and a half weeks no major side affect ontil about yesterday I noticed my stomach started cramping I'm really worrid I have a bowel disease now is 2 and a half weeks long enough to cause that? Or to do any permanent affects?

Dear Jake: Accutane has many side-effects and you being concerned is reasonable. The use of accutane may cause colitis, esophagitis, nausea, pancreatitis and inflammatory bowel disease. I would advise you to discontinue the drug and see your doctor if you experience abdominal pain, loose stools or rectal bleeding. Your doctor may require a complete blood count, sedimentation rate, glucose, CPK and LFT to determine the cause of pain.
